Aircraft Update:
EC-MVM Airbus A320-232 c/n 2747 Vueling Airlines for delivery ex Shannon x EI-GEK.
EC-MVN Airbus A320-232 c/n 2753 Vueling Airlines for delivery ex Shannon ex EI-GEL
EI-GEZ Boeing 737-73V c/n 32413 BBAM A/c Leasing Ferried Soekarno–Hatta International-Sharjah-Lasham 15-16/03/18 for JetTime ex HL8207.
VP-BDR Boeing 777-212 c/n 28532 Standard Chartered Avn Finance Ferried Kula Lumpur-Alice Springs 15/03/18 after storage ex EI-FNN.
